South Cotabato HPG agents arrest van driver without license, franchise but with shabu

KORONADAL CITY - No public transportation franchise, no driver's license and sachets of prohibited drugs landed a van driver from Sultan Naga Dimaporo,Lanao del Norte to jail in South Cotabato Wednesday.Dodong Tacbas, 46 of Sultan Naga Dimaporo town in Lanao del Nortehas no vehicle franchise but used his van as passenger vehicle with 10 passengers, according to Chief Inspector Arnold Carino. Worst he was driving without license to drive which is a basic requirement, Carnio, chief of South Cotabato Highway Patrol, told DXOM-AM Radyo Bida.HP operatives have established a highway checkpoint in Barangay Morales here and flagged down Tacbas who was suspiciously driving a van without franchise markings on its sides. Carino said Tacbas' van was carrying about 10 passengerson their way to Gen. Santos City.When Carino asked Tacbas for his driver's license, the visibly thrilleddriver pulled his wallet, in the process, exposing a sachet of shabu.After inspection, more sachets of prohibited drugs were found in Tacbas' van. Carino said his office earlier received a tip that a colorum passneger van from Lanao del Norte is passing by Korondal City with prohibited drugs in it.
